Why Fairy and Moon Tattoos?
Seriously, why are these designs so popular?
I think it’s because they represent a lot of things.
Think about it:
Fairies symbolize:
- Innocence and youth: That nostalgic feeling of childhood wonder.
- Magic and mystery: A connection to the unseen.
- Transformation and change: Growing and evolving.
And the moon?
The moon screams:
- Femininity and intuition: That deep, inner knowing.
- Cycles and rhythms: The ebb and flow of life.
- Guidance and protection: A light in the darkness.
Combined, you’ve got a powerful symbol of growth, intuition, and a touch of magic.

Placement is Key: Where Should You Get Your Fairy and Moon Tattoo?
Placement can totally change the vibe of your tattoo.
Here are a few popular spots:
- Back (Shoulder Blade or Upper Back): Great for larger, more detailed designs.
- Arm (Upper Arm, Forearm, or Wrist): Visible and easily shown off.
- Ankle or Foot: More discreet and dainty.
- Ribcage: Can be sexy and mysterious.
- Behind the Ear: Tiny and super cute.
Important: Consider your pain tolerance when choosing a placement.
Ribcage and feet can be pretty sensitive!

Finding the Right Artist
This is crucial!
Do your research.
- Check their portfolio: Make sure they have experience with the style you want.
- Read reviews: See what other people have to say about their work.
- Schedule a consultation: Talk to them about your ideas and get their input.
Fairy and Moon Tattoo: Things to Consider
- Size and Detail: Intricate designs require more space.
- Color vs. Black and Gray: Color can add vibrancy, but black and gray tend to age better.
- Longevity: Tattoos fade over time, so choose a design and placement that will still look good years from now.
